Russian Qt Forum
Ноябрь 23, 2024, 03:29
Добро пожаловать,
Гость
. Пожалуйста,
войдите
или
зарегистрируйтесь
.
Вам не пришло
письмо с кодом активации?
1 час
1 день
1 неделя
1 месяц
Навсегда
Войти
Начало
Форум
WIKI (Вики)
FAQ
Помощь
Поиск
Войти
Регистрация
Russian Qt Forum
>
Forum
>
Qt
>
Общие вопросы
>
защита программы от копирования
Страниц:
1
2
[
3
]
4
Вниз
« предыдущая тема
следующая тема »
Печать
Автор
Тема: защита программы от копирования (Прочитано 25368 раз)
qate
Супер
Offline
Сообщений: 1177
Re: защита программы от копирования
«
Ответ #30 :
Январь 28, 2015, 08:36 »
привязка к имени компьютера это как ? )
виртуалка все это "вскроет" сразу
бегло посмотрел пару сайтов usb ключей (SenseLock, Guardant) - под linux мало что написано или не работает
что хуже - софт их закрыт, в данном случаи это критичным момент (хз что они там делают)
Записан
Igors
Джедай : наставник для всех
Offline
Сообщений: 11445
Re: защита программы от копирования
«
Ответ #31 :
Январь 28, 2015, 10:01 »
Цитата: qate от Январь 28, 2015, 08:36
привязка к имени компьютера это как ? )
виртуалка все это "вскроет" сразу
Вскроет что? Что авторизация рассчитана на это, конкретное имя? Так этого никто и не скрывает. Да, он может переименовать и будет работать - но неудобства созданы
Цитата: qate от Январь 28, 2015, 08:36
бегло посмотрел пару сайтов usb ключей (SenseLock, Guardant) - под linux мало что написано или не работает
что хуже - софт их закрыт, в данном случаи это критичным момент (хз что они там делают)
С хардварным ключом - др разговор, но он денег стоит, и каждого юзверя этим ключом надо снабжать. Вы определитесь
Еще подход. Копия ни к чему не привязывается, но имеет уникальный код который рассылает по UDP. Та же копия на др машине ловит и если коды совпадают - вываливается, мол, извините, такой уже есть в сети. Необходимость все время вытаскивать кабель достает капитально, а без сети не обойтись
Вообще здесь скромнее = лучше, иначе все свалится в "все равно сломают" (лапки вверх). Создать "некоторые трудности" обычно вполне достаточно, Каждому кажется что его софт - лучший в мире, это нормально
Но далеко не все юзвери будут прилагать усилия для его использования (типа VM, сидеть с неверной датой, менять имя и.т.п)
Записан
Bepec
Гость
Re: защита программы от копирования
«
Ответ #32 :
Январь 28, 2015, 12:48 »
Эти все способы, Igors работают только тогда, когда нет установщика, а есть лишь установленная программа.
А насколько я понимаю ТСса, установщик как раз и будет поставляться
Записан
qate
Супер
Offline
Сообщений: 1177
Re: защита программы от копирования
«
Ответ #33 :
Январь 28, 2015, 12:48 »
Цитата: Igors от Январь 28, 2015, 10:01
Да, он может переименовать и будет работать - но неудобства созданы
защита "для галочки" мне не нужна, неудобства должны быть более сложные
Цитата: Igors от Январь 28, 2015, 10:01
С хардварным ключом - др разговор, но он денег стоит, и каждого юзверя этим ключом надо снабжать. Вы определитесь
я и пытаюсь опеределится, для того и создан топик
да, ключи вносят свои неудобства
Цитата: Igors от Январь 28, 2015, 10:01
Еще подход. Копия ни к чему не привязывается, но имеет уникальный код который рассылает по UDP. Та же копия на др машине ловит и если коды совпадают - вываливается, мол, извините, такой уже есть в сети. Необходимость все время вытаскивать кабель достает капитально, а без сети не обойтись
как базовая идея интересна, попробую обдумать
Записан
qate
Супер
Offline
Сообщений: 1177
Re: защита программы от копирования
«
Ответ #34 :
Январь 28, 2015, 12:52 »
Цитата: Bepec от Январь 28, 2015, 12:48
Эти все способы, Igors работают только тогда, когда нет установщика, а есть лишь установленная программа.
А насколько я понимаю ТСса, установщик как раз и будет поставляться
не совсем понял мысль, на данный момент "поставка" это архив - распаковал и работай
Записан
Bepec
Гость
Re: защита программы от копирования
«
Ответ #35 :
Январь 28, 2015, 14:32 »
Я о чем и говорю - в архиве имеется непривязанная версия. Привязка осуществится только при первом запуске. Значит достаточно просто выложить этот архив на обменник
Хотя я видел пару программ, что получали информацию о компьютере посредством java аплетов на странице, потом видимо компилировали программу с этими данными и только тогда высылали архив
Записан
Igors
Джедай : наставник для всех
Offline
Сообщений: 11445
Re: защита программы от копирования
«
Ответ #36 :
Январь 28, 2015, 15:44 »
Цитата: qate от Январь 28, 2015, 12:48
защита "для галочки" мне не нужна, неудобства должны быть более сложные
У меня есть редактор для работы с изображениями у которого защита всего лишь: на старте показывается типа "Вы не купили, ждите 30 сек". И через пол-минуты все запускается без всяких ограничений. Возможно Вам такая защита покажется смехотворной - но уверяю Вас, при интенсивном юзании это серьезная проблема!
Записан
Пантер
Administrator
Джедай : наставник для всех
Offline
Сообщений: 5876
Жаждущий знаний
Re: защита программы от копирования
«
Ответ #37 :
Январь 28, 2015, 16:35 »
Цитата: Igors от Январь 28, 2015, 15:44
Цитата: qate от Январь 28, 2015, 12:48
защита "для галочки" мне не нужна, неудобства должны быть более сложные
У меня есть редактор для работы с изображениями у которого защита всего лишь: на старте показывается типа "Вы не купили, ждите 30 сек". И через пол-минуты все запускается без всяких ограничений. Возможно Вам такая защита покажется смехотворной - но уверяю Вас, при интенсивном юзании это серьезная проблема!
Наг-скрин называется, вроде. ТоталКоммандер такой юзает.
Записан
1. Qt - Qt Development Frameworks; QT - QuickTime
2. Не используйте в исходниках символы кириллицы!!!
3. Пользуйтесь тегом code при оформлении сообщений.
kambala
Джедай : наставник для всех
Offline
Сообщений: 4747
Re: защита программы от копирования
«
Ответ #38 :
Январь 28, 2015, 23:33 »
у тотала просто «нажмите кнопку и будет вам счастье». а вот в xvid4psp надо ждать по 10 секунд после запуска — да, слегка напрягает.
еще можно просто убивать программу по прошествии некоторого времени (как в Charles Proxy) — тоже напрягать будет, особенно если не сохранять ничего и юзера не предупреждать. можно рандомное время брать типа 10 +- минут.
Записан
Изучением C++ вымощена дорога в Qt.
UTF-8 has been around since 1993 and Unicode 2.0 since 1996; if you have created any 8-bit character content since 1996 in anything other than UTF-8, then I hate you. © Matt Gallagher
m_ax
Джедай : наставник для всех
Offline
Сообщений: 2095
Re: защита программы от копирования
«
Ответ #39 :
Январь 29, 2015, 00:07 »
Можно сделать проще.. С помощью исключений.. Но, имхо, под линуксом защищать свои творения - это последнее дело..( Ведь Вам предоставляют свободную и открытую ОС.. А Вы..
Записан
Над водой луна двурога. Сяду выпью за Ван Гога. Хорошо, что кот не пьет, Он и так меня поймет..
Arch Linux Plasma 5
Bepec
Гость
Re: защита программы от копирования
«
Ответ #40 :
Январь 29, 2015, 00:33 »
Все хотят кушать. И не хлебушек с водичкой, а батончик с икоркой.
Записан
m_ax
Джедай : наставник для всех
Offline
Сообщений: 2095
Re: защита программы от копирования
«
Ответ #41 :
Январь 29, 2015, 00:37 »
Все хотят кушать, да.. Но у всех есть выбор..
Записан
Над водой луна двурога. Сяду выпью за Ван Гога. Хорошо, что кот не пьет, Он и так меня поймет..
Arch Linux Plasma 5
qate
Супер
Offline
Сообщений: 1177
Re: защита программы от копирования
«
Ответ #42 :
Январь 29, 2015, 09:08 »
Цитата: Igors от Январь 28, 2015, 15:44
У меня есть редактор для работы с изображениями у которого защита всего лишь: на старте показывается типа "Вы не купили, ждите 30 сек". И через пол-минуты все запускается без всяких ограничений. Возможно Вам такая защита покажется смехотворной - но уверяю Вас, при интенсивном юзании это серьезная проблема!
так это не защита - это реакция на не прохождение защиты
интересует именно сам механизм защиты
Записан
qate
Супер
Offline
Сообщений: 1177
Re: защита программы от копирования
«
Ответ #43 :
Январь 29, 2015, 09:09 »
Цитата: m_ax от Январь 29, 2015, 00:07
Но, имхо, под линуксом защищать свои творения - это последнее дело..( Ведь Вам предоставляют свободную и открытую ОС.. А Вы..
в каком месте нарушается лицензия на свободную и открытую ОС ?
Записан
__Heaven__
Джедай : наставник для всех
Offline
Сообщений: 2130
Re: защита программы от копирования
«
Ответ #44 :
Январь 29, 2015, 09:39 »
Цитата: qate от Январь 29, 2015, 09:09
Цитата: m_ax от Январь 29, 2015, 00:07
Но, имхо, под линуксом защищать свои творения - это последнее дело..( Ведь Вам предоставляют свободную и открытую ОС.. А Вы..
в каком месте нарушается лицензия на свободную и открытую ОС ?
m_ax имел в виду, что сообщество предоставляет ОС бесплатно, что платные программы под ней как-то не по совести
Записан
Страниц:
1
2
[
3
]
4
Вверх
Печать
« предыдущая тема
следующая тема »
Перейти в:
Пожалуйста, выберите назначение:
-----------------------------
Qt
-----------------------------
=> Вопросы новичков
=> Уроки и статьи
=> Установка, сборка, отладка, тестирование
=> Общие вопросы
=> Пользовательский интерфейс (GUI)
=> Qt Quick
=> Model-View (MV)
=> Базы данных
=> Работа с сетью
=> Многопоточное программирование, процессы
=> Мультимедиа
=> 2D и 3D графика
=> OpenGL
=> Печать
=> Интернационализация, локализация
=> QSS
=> XML
=> Qt Script, QtWebKit
=> ActiveX
=> Qt Embedded
=> Дополнительные компоненты
=> Кладовая готовых решений
=> Вклад сообщества в Qt
=> Qt-инструментарий
-----------------------------
Программирование
-----------------------------
=> Общий
=> С/C++
=> Python
=> Алгоритмы
=> Базы данных
=> Разработка игр
-----------------------------
Компиляторы и платформы
-----------------------------
=> Linux
=> Windows
=> Mac OS X
=> Компиляторы
===> Visual C++
-----------------------------
Разное
-----------------------------
=> Новости
===> Новости Qt сообщества
===> Новости IT сферы
=> Говорилка
=> Юмор
=> Объявления
Загружается...